Bayanin samfur

MXion BASIC-S babban sauti ne mai sauqi qwarai don tsarin analog da dijital.
Akwai adadin shirye-shiryen sautuna don BASIC-S (kan buƙata a kowane lokaci mai faɗaɗawa). Ta hanyar amfani da na'ura mai sarrafawa guda ɗaya ba tare da kwakwalwan ƙwaƙwalwar ajiya na waje ba wannan ƙirar tana da farashi mai ban sha'awa.
Sautunan da aka riga aka kera (suuri, dizal, da lantarki) ana kiyaye su da sauƙi kuma ba su da hayaniya.
Amma yana yiwuwa a cikin dijital har zuwa ƙarin sautuna 3 (ƙaho, kararrawa da busa) maidowa.
Ko da saituna daban-daban, f-key assignment yana da shirye-shirye. Bugu da ƙari, ƙarar ta hanyar CV da poti saita agogon da aka haɗa da sauti (a cikin yanayin dijital) kunna/kashe. Ko bebe yana yiwuwa kuma za a san poti ta atomatik.
Ana iya daidaita simintin agogo (ko agogon waje).
Da kyau, wannan tsarin sautin kuma yana yiwuwa don "fun" sauti kamar waƙoƙin Coca-Cola®, rawan kaza, waƙoƙin Kirsimeti da ƙari mai yawa. Ana ci gaba da faɗaɗa ɗakin karatu ta yadda za ku iya zaɓar daga zaɓi mai faɗi.

kararrawa Church sauti

Siffa ta musamman ita ce sautin coci. Wannan ingantaccen ƙararrawa mai inganci, ƙaramar coci ta Turai tana ba da damar haraji iri-iri. Abu ɗaya, yawanci ta hanyar maɓallin aiki da adireshin locomotive kamar yadda aka saba. Amma sarrafawa na musamman ne kwatsam (CV127) kuma yana iya kasancewa ta CV129 mafi ƙarancin tazara za'a iya daidaita shi. CV130 yana nuna tsawon lokacin kunna kararrawa yana gudana. Sarrafa ta hanyar dijital na musamman ne (hanzari) lokacin jirgin ƙasa. Anan aika babban ofishin (idan yana goyan bayan shi) lokacin jirgin ƙasa ɗaya (yiwuwar haɓaka). Za'a iya daidaita wannan tsarin bisa ga wannan lokacin kuma saboda haka shine madaidaicin abin da ke jawo bayan lokacin jirgin ƙasa kamar kowane samfurin ruwan sama ko kowane sa'o'i 6. Ana iya saita wannan a cikin CV128. Wannan CV yana nuna alamar rabo. Yi magana ƙimar 6 zai haifar da daidai kowane awa 6 daidai.
Idan ka ƙara 128 (a cikin wannan yanayin 134) za a kira kowane minti 6.

Lura: Ba duk tashoshin tsakiya na dijital ba ne ke goyan bayan lokacin jirgin ƙasa samfurin (misali kamar 30Z ɗin mu zai yi). Sai dai idan yana goyan bayan sarrafa dijital, ƙirar kanta tana ƙididdige lokacin da tsarin ya fara girma a ainihin lokacin (1 sec = 1 sec).
A cikin analoge, kararrawa ta zo da bazuwar, kuma manuel na iya haifar da shi.

Kulle shirye-shirye

Don hana shirye-shiryen bazata don hana CV 15/16 kulle shirye-shirye ɗaya. Sai kawai idan CV 15 = CV 16 yana yiwuwa yiwuwar shirye-shirye. Canza CV 16 yana canzawa ta atomatik kuma CV 15.
Tare da CV 7 = 16 na iya sake saita kulle shirye-shirye.

STANDARD DARAJAR CV 15/16 = 130

Zaɓuɓɓukan shirye-shirye

Wannan ƙaddamarwa tana goyan bayan nau'ikan shirye-shirye masu zuwa: bitwise, POM da CV karanta & rubuta da yanayin rajista.
Ba za a sami ƙarin nauyi don shirye-shirye ba.
A cikin POM (programming akan maintrack) ana kuma goyan bayan kulle shirye-shirye.
Hakanan na'urar za ta iya kasancewa a kan babban waƙar da aka tsara ba tare da wani tasiri ba. Don haka, lokacin da ake yin shirye-shirye ba za a iya cire maɓalli ba.
NOTE: Don amfani da POM ba tare da wasu na'urar bugu ba dole ne ya shafi POM na cibiyar dijital ku zuwa takamaiman adiresoshin mai yankewa

Shirye-shiryen ƙimar binary
Wasu CV's (misali 29) sun ƙunshi abin da ake kira ƙimar binary. Ma'anar cewa saituna da yawa a cikin ƙima. Kowane aiki yana da ɗan matsayi da ƙima. Don shirye-shiryen irin wannan CV dole ne a sami duk mahimman abubuwan da za a iya ƙarawa. Aikin nakasa yana da ƙimar 0 koyaushe.
EXAMPLE: Kuna son matakan tuƙi 28 da adireshin loco mai tsayi. Don yin wannan, dole ne ku saita ƙimar a cikin CV 29 2 + 32 = 34 da aka tsara.

Ikon buffer
Haɗa buffer kai tsaye DEC+ da DEC-.
Ana buƙatar capacitors, muddin ba a haɗa na'urorin caji ba, tare da resistor na 120 ohms da diode a layi daya tsakanin DEC+ da tashar jiragen ruwa (+) na buffer. Dash akan diode (cathode) dole ne a haɗa shi zuwa DEC+ zama. Mai ƙididdigewa ya ƙunshi babu ɗaya naúrar sarrafa buffer.

Shirye-shiryen loco address
Locomotives har zuwa 127 ana tsara su kai tsaye zuwa CV 1. Don wannan, kuna buƙatar CV 29 Bit 5 "kashe" (zai saita ta atomatik).
Idan an yi amfani da manyan adireshi, CV 29 – Bit 5 dole ne a “kunne” (ta atomatik idan an canza CV 17/18). Adireshin yanzu yana cikin CV 17 da CV 18 da aka adana. Adireshin shine kamar haka (misali adireshin loco 3000):
3000 / 256 = 11,72; CV 17 shine 192 + 11 = 203.
3000 - (11 x 256) = 184; CV 18 shine 184.

Bayanan fasaha

Wutar lantarki: 4-27V DC/DCC
3-18V AC
Yanzu: 10mA (ba tare da sauti ba)
Matsakaicin halin yanzu: 1 Amps.
Yanayin zafin jiki: -20 zuwa 65 ° C
Girma L*B*H (cm): 2.4*4*2.5
NOTE: Idan kuna da niyyar amfani da wannan na'urar a ƙasan yanayin sanyi, tabbatar cewa an adana ta a cikin wani wuri mai zafi kafin a fara aiki don hana samar da ruwa mai narkewa. Yayin aiki ya isa ya hana ruwa mai laushi.
